Frequently Asked Questions

How do Wright State University-Main Campus and Sonoma State University compare?
Wright State University-Main Campus (Dayton, OH) has an acceptance rate of 96.3%, in-state tuition of $11,522, and median 10-year earnings of $49,500. Sonoma State University (Rohnert Park, CA) has an acceptance rate of 93.4%, in-state tuition of $8,624, and median 10-year earnings of $65,986.
Which school has higher graduate earnings, Wright State University-Main Campus or Sonoma State University?
Sonoma State University graduates earn more at 10 years out, with a median of $65,986 vs $49,500. Source: U.S. Department of Education College Scorecard.
Which school is more affordable, Wright State University-Main Campus or Sonoma State University?
Based on average net price (after grants and scholarships), Sonoma State University is the more affordable option at $12,885 per year versus $15,415.
Which school has a better 4-year graduation rate?
Sonoma State University has the higher 4-year graduation rate: 59.1% vs 43.9%.
